MONTHLY MAINTENANCE
Lubrication is critical to jacks, since they support heavy loads. Any restriction due to dirt or
rust can cause slow jack movement or extremely rapid jerks, causing damage to the internal
components. To keep the jack well lubricated, carry out the following steps.
LOWERING A VEHICLE
1. Turn the release valve clockwise to close it.
2. Pump the handle to raise the vehicle off the jack stands.
3. Remove the jack stands from beneath the vehicle.
4. Turn the release valve slowly counter-clockwise to lower the vehicle to the ground.
NOTE: When the jack is not in use, ALWAYS leave the saddle and ram fully retracted.
